All of the Places to Shop for Baby Shower Decorations

without comments

In the event that you are left in total charge of hosting a baby shower and personally you don’t have the slightest clue where you should go to purchase all of the decorations for the baby shower, there is no need to worry. There are a couple of  different places that you can visit, where you will find a wide variety of different decorations for the baby shower that won’t put a big dent in your wallet.

Take the time to find one of these types of locations and you are going to surely find everything that you need in order to host a spectacular event.

1) Party Supply Stores within Your Community- Out of all of the options you have, This is certainly the most expensive one, however it is going to be the best stocked in order to handle all of your needs. At the party supply store, you are going to be able to purchase balloon weights and balloons, along with paper goods and decorations for the baby shower.

2) The Dollar Stores- Dollar Stores, believe it or not, aren’t just for all of those tiny, little nick nacks that you find all around the house any longer. Within most of the dollar store chains, now they have a brand new role, if not several rows of party supplies. Wall hangings, streamers, and signs are all available and will make really great decorations for the baby shower. There are some of the dollar stores that even has some type of balloon services, so you may get lucky and be able to pass right by the party supply store altogether.

3) The Discount Stores- Even though their not as high priced as all of your local party stores, the amount of decorations that you can use for a baby shower found at this these stores are limited. Most of the discount stores that are in a big chain are trying to offer something for each and every individual, which in turn means that they can’t simply carry everything. Even though you are going to be able to find some really great deals on all of the decorations that can be used for a baby shower, it isn’t going to be everything that is going to make your baby shower perfect.

4) Online Retailers- On the internet, you can purchase everything. Wall signs, streamers, flowers and wall decorations. The only decoration that is going to be difficult to order off of the internet is going to be helium balloons but wait; you can purchase balloons with a personal, mini helium tank. The only thing that you need to remember when you order something online is that you have to allow time for delivery.

Overall, if you go to these places to find your decorations for the baby shower, you are going to find everything that you need.

Food Ideas for the Baby Shower

without comments

As you may already know, a successful baby shower is going to start with all of the right food. A very important part of planning someone a baby shower that is going to be successful is serving only food that is convenient to eat and tasty. When it comes to the food that is served at the baby shower, you can either have all of the food catered, or you can order some deli trays from your local supermarket or, if you really enjoy cooking and you have the extra time, you can prepare all of the food yourself.

Below, you will find a list of several different food items that you can serve at the baby shower that are very easy to prepare and are easy to eat and tasty. However, there are some things that you need to figure out before you move on to the food. First, decide what type of baby shower you are interested in planning and exactly where it is going to be held.

In the event that it is a casual party that is going to be held at someone else’s home, then you can plan to serve food that is going to be easy to handle and not really all that messy. If all of the guests are going to have their plates in their laps, you aren’t going to want to serve any type of food that is messy. In the event there are going to be some tables set up for all of the guests to sit at, you can be a bit more adventurous with all of the food. 

  • Chips and Dip- Your selection may include tortilla chips accompanied by guacamole, salsa, sour cream, bean dip or a variety of different potato chips with ranch dip and onion dip.
  • Spinach Dip- Your selection maybe accompanied by crackers, raw vegetables, pita triangles or toast rounds.
  • Seafood Spinach Dip- add a half of cup of crab meat, if you don’t have any crab meat, the imitation seafood legs will work just as well, make sure that you shred them before you add them to the mixture. If you would like, you can use artichokes or spinach or you may want to omit both.
  • Spinach Artichoke Dip- add one fourteen ounce can of artichokes that have been drained and chopped to the spinach dip.
  • Hummus- Your selection can be accompanied by toast rounds, pita chips, carrot sticks and celery.

Now that you have a little knowledge of how your menu is supposed to look for the baby shower, you can make all of the final adjustments to the menu. Make sure that you know everything you plan to cook and what all you are going to need to prepare it.
